Market Context

Nuveen (NKX) has seen a modest pullback in recent sessions, trading at $12.44 with a decline of 1.10% as of this week. The stock remains within a defined range, with support near $11.82 and resistance around $13.06. Trading volume has been slightly below the recent monthly average, suggesting a lack of strong directional conviction among market participants. This sideways price action comes amid a broader environment where fixed-income and closed-end fund sectors have experienced mixed sentiment, as investors weigh interest rate expectations against inflation data that continues to evolve. The recent dip appears driven by profit-taking after NKX briefly approached the upper end of its range, rather than a fundamental shift in the fund’s outlook. Sector positioning remains cautious; other municipal bond and income-focused funds have also exhibited similar consolidation patterns, reflecting a wait-and-see approach ahead of upcoming economic releases. The broader market’s sensitivity to rate-sensitive assets has kept NKX in a tight band, with the stock trading between support and resistance for several weeks. Volume patterns indicate that neither buyers nor sellers have seized control, leaving NKX susceptible to short-term volatility tied to macroeconomic headlines. If the stock can hold above its support level, it may attempt to retest resistance, though a break below could invite further selling pressure. Technical Analysis

Nuveen (NKX) currently trades at $12.44, positioning the stock within a defined range bounded by key support at $11.82 and resistance at $13.06. In recent weeks, the price has oscillated near the middle of this channel, suggesting a phase of consolidation as buyers and sellers await a catalyst for the next directional move. The support level has been tested multiple times in the past months and has held, reinforcing its significance as a floor where accumulation may occur. Conversely, the resistance near $13.06 has capped upside attempts, with each rally faltering around that zone and leading to pullbacks. Short-term price action reveals a series of higher lows, hinting at underlying bullish momentum that could eventually challenge resistance if sustained. However, failure to break above $13.06 in the near term would keep the stock range-bound, with a potential retest of the $11.82 support if selling pressure increases. Volume has been moderate during recent moves, lacking the conviction typically seen in breakout or breakdown scenarios. Technical indicators are mixed: momentum oscillators appear neutral to slightly oversold, while moving averages are converging, reflecting the indecisive trend. A decisive close above $13.06 would signal a breakout, while a drop below $11.82 could invite further downside. Traders should monitor volume and price action at these boundaries for confirmation. Outlook

Looking ahead, Nuveen (NKX) finds itself trading near the midpoint of a defined range, with support at $11.82 and resistance at $13.06. The recent 1.10% decline to $12.44 suggests a cautious tone among market participants, reflecting broader uncertainty in fixed-income and closed-end fund sectors. Near-term price action may hinge on whether NKX can hold above the support level; a breakdown below $11.82 could signal increased selling pressure and a potential test of lower support zones. Conversely, a rebound toward $13.06 would require sustained buying volume and favorable shifts in interest rate expectations. Key factors that could influence future performance include the Federal Reserve's monetary policy trajectory, as rising rates tend to pressure leveraged funds like NKX. Additionally, any changes in the fund's distribution coverage or net asset value trends would be closely watched. Analysts suggest that the yield environment and investor sentiment toward income-generating vehicles will remain primary drivers. In the absence of recent earnings releases for this fund—given its structure as a closed-end fund—market data and macroeconomic indicators will likely guide short-term movements. The stock may continue to consolidate within the current trading band unless a clear catalyst emerges, such as a shift in credit spreads or a decisive break of the established support or resistance levels.
